Title:
METHOD FOR PRODUCING PLANT BENZYLISOQUINOLINE ALKALOID
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2012/039438
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
A method for synthesizing (s)-reticulin being important as a junction intermediate in biosynthetic pathway of benzylisoquinoline alkaloid by culturing the transgenic microbes expressing the enzyme necessary for the biosynthesis.
